Are you having trouble adapting your B2B business strategies to today’s disruptive world? If you answered yes, this episode is for you.

Leading SMB Growth Expert Michael Haynes joins me to talk about how you should strategize to keep your company on top amidst constantly changing consumer needs.

We cover topics such as understanding the demands of a market, overcoming weaknesses of a company, and Michael’s new mastermind program called “Empower.”

About Our Guest:

Michael Haynes is the Founder and Principal Consultant at Listen Innovate Grow with over 20 years of experience working with firms ranging from micro-businesses to large corporations in Australia and Canada to develop and implement customer strategies and programs that help them expand their businesses.
